Answer:

Both angles have a measure of 134degrees, y = 27degrees.

Explanation:

As per what is given in the problem:

There are 2 parallel lines, both are intersected by a transversal.

Remember the theorem, when two parallel lines are intersected by a transversal, then the alternate exterior angles are congruent.

The is meanse that:

3y + 53 = 7y - 55

Solve using inverse operations:

3y + 53 = 7y - 55

+55 +55

3y + 108 = 7y

-3y -3y

108 = 4y

/4 /4

27 = y

Now, substitute back in to find the value of the angle:

3y + 53

y = 27

3 ( 27 ) + 53

81 + 53

= 134

Since the angles are alternate exterior, they are congruent, hence both angles have a measure of 134degrees.
